Dive into JavaScript tutorials, tips, and tools for developers of
JavaScript is a versatile and essential language for web development. This category provides comprehensive tutorials, practical tips, and recommendations for the best tools to enhance your JavaScript skills. Whether you're a beginner or an experienced developer, you'll find resources to help you write better code, build efficient applications, and stay ahead of the curve in this ever-evolving field.
Comprehensive List for JavaScript Tutorials, Tips, and Tools
JavaScript Basics for Beginners
Learn the building blocks of JavaScript, such as variables, data types, loops, conditionals, and functions. This foundational knowledge is essential for understanding how JavaScript powers websites and applications.
ES6+ Features
Explore modern JavaScript enhancements introduced with ES6 and beyond. Key features include arrow functions, template literals, destructuring assignments, and async/await for asynchronous programming. These updates make coding more efficient and readable.
DOM Manipulation
Discover how to dynamically interact with HTML and CSS using JavaScript. Learn to select elements, change styles, handle events, and create responsive, user-friendly web pages.
Debugging Techniques
Master the art of debugging by using browser-based tools like Chrome DevTools. Learn to identify and fix errors, analyze performance bottlenecks, and write bug-free code.
JavaScript Frameworks
Dive into popular frameworks like React, Vue, and Angular. These frameworks simplify complex tasks, speed up development, and allow you to create powerful single-page applications (SPAs).
Code Optimization
Enhance your JavaScript code by adopting best practices such as modular coding, minimizing global variables, and using efficient algorithms. Optimized code improves performance and maintainability.
API Integration
Learn how to fetch and manipulate external data using JavaScript. Understand tools like the Fetch API and Axios for making HTTP requests and handling JSON responses effectively.
Testing Tools
Explore testing frameworks like Jest and Mocha. Writing tests for your JavaScript code ensures it works as expected and helps you identify bugs early in development.
Code Editors and Extensions
Use editors like Visual Studio Code for a seamless coding experience. Boost productivity with extensions such as Prettier for formatting, ESLint for linting, and Live Server for real-time previews.
Performance Best Practices
Optimize JavaScript for better performance by reducing unused code, implementing lazy loading, using asynchronous functions, and minifying your scripts. These techniques ensure faster and smoother applications for users.